Mrs Murray's was founded back in 1889, named after our founder Mrs Susan Murray, who worked tirelessly to provide food and a place of refuge for stray dogs and cats in the City and Shire of Aberdeen. She was the widow of a local advocate.
The Home has since expanded to take in animals from their owners who, for a variety of reasons can no longer keep them and find new homes for them.
Each year around 1000 animals pass through our doors - Most abandoned and unwanted.
The Home serves the North East of Scotland and is a registered charity. We receive no government funding and is largely dependent on legacies, donations and the support of the public to help fund the cost of looking after the animals and securing their future.
